Sadaqah-tul-Fitr (Zakat-ul-Fitr) is a duty performed by every Muslim at the end of the month of Ramadan. It serves two primary purposes: - Purification: To cleanse the fasting person from any indecent act or speech during Ramadan. - Support: To provide food and assistance to the poor and needy so they may celebrate Eid-ul-Fitr. Who Must Pay? This is a mandatory obligation for every member of your household, including children and infants. The head of the household may pay on behalf of all dependents.
